Transaction c3ca74071b656bb9288a1a32d74168fa67fb93039b54492b4c97ccc5e180a543
1 Input
1 Output
-
c3ca74071b656bb9288a1a32d74168fa67fb93039b54492b4c97ccc5e180a543:0
- value
- 89616659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fd85f4d80287c618d977a9b6a23f265bcb017cb OP_EQUAL
- address
- 34bQ5JLqHChTdb71vjpRysrx2vuGEwGFMH